Baltimore County police are searching for the woman who committed an armed robbery of the 1st Mariner Bank in the 7000 block of Security Boulevard in Woodlawn. Detectives say that at 9:41 a.m. Saturday, the robber entered the bank, passed a teller a note demanding money and displayed a handgun. The teller gave the robber an undisclosed amount of cash and she left in a silver two-door Acura with a sunroof and spoiler, police said.
The suspect is described as about 25, 5 feet 2 inches with brown braided hair. She wore jeans, large sunglasses and a brown jacket, police said.
